Fishing info Hesperia Lake:

Fishing permits are $12.00 per person, $7 for seniors(M-F), and $10 for Hesperia residents, (M-F). Children are $3 and have a two fish limit. (or they can pay the adult rate and catch 5 fish) No license is required. There are two fishing sessions per day; 6: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. and 1:00 p.m. to 10:00 p.m. The lake is stocked with trout in the winter and catfish during the summer. There are also bluegill, largemouth bass, and carp in here.
